I was going over the dependencies for the JBJCA project and needed a tool to
get an overview of dependencies between jar files, if a class is located in
multiple jar files and an overview of what each jar file requires and
provides.
So I hacked something together; currently called Tattletale - based on
javassist.jar of course.
